ToolboxItem.Deserialize(SerializationInfo, StreamingContext) Méthode

Définition

Charge l’état de l’élément de boîte à outils à partir de l’objet d’informations de sérialisation spécifié.

protected:
 virtual void Deserialize(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
protected virtual void Deserialize(System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
abstract member Deserialize :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> unit
override this.Deserialize :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> unit
Protected Overridable Sub Deserialize (info As SerializationInfo, context As StreamingContext)

Paramètres

info
SerializationInfo

À SerializationInfo partir duquel charger.

context
StreamingContext

Qui StreamingContext indique les caractéristiques du flux.

Exemples

L’exemple de code suivant illustre le chargement de l’état de l’élément de boîte à outils à partir de l’objet d’informations de sérialisation spécifié. Cet exemple de code fait partie d’un exemple plus grand fourni pour la ToolboxItem classe.

MyToolboxItem(SerializationInfo info, StreamingContext context) => Deserialize(info, context);
Sub New(ByVal info As SerializationInfo, _
    ByVal context As StreamingContext)
    Deserialize(info, context)
End Sub

Notes pour les héritiers

Les méthodes et Serialize(SerializationInfo, StreamingContext) les Deserialize(SerializationInfo, StreamingContext) méthodes doivent être implémentées dans les classes qui dérivent ToolboxItem pour prendre en charge la persistance dans la base de données de boîte à outils fournie par certains environnements de développement.

S’applique à